Management Accounting Framework

Management Accounting Framework refers to the structured approach businesses use to gather, analyze, and interpret financial and non-financial information to support internal decision-making. It involves setting organizational objectives, collecting relevant data, applying analytical tools, and communicating insights to managers. This framework helps in planning, controlling operations, budgeting, and evaluating performance, ultimately aiding managers in making informed, strategic choices to achieve the company's goals efficiently and effectively.
